The Chief Minister's Office of Chhattisgarh turned the spotlight on water on Wednesday, 19 August 2026, sharing a live broadcast of 'Srot Mahotsav' — a departmental festival organised by the state's Water Resources Department.
The post, shared from the official CMO handle, linked directly to the broadcast of the event, signalling the government's intent to bring public attention to its water-sector work. 'स्रोत महोत्सव' — literally 'Festival of the Source' — is the name given to this departmental showcase.

What Srot Mahotsav Represents

State governments across India periodically organise such departmental festivals to place their ongoing work — irrigation projects, reservoir management, water conservation drives — in front of the public. The Water Resources Department of Chhattisgarh oversees a network of irrigation infrastructure that is central to the livelihoods of the state's farming communities. By streaming the event and amplifying it through the CMO's official handle, the government signals that water management is a priority worth public visibility. For a state where agriculture remains the backbone of the rural economy, a festival dedicated to water sources carries weight beyond ceremony. Farmers dependent on canal networks and reservoirs have a direct stake in how the department communicates its plans and progress.
